Wellington Markets.
j A. G. Tame and Co. report of the i market for the week ending 15th Jnly ; — Fat sheep —Market steadily hardening , and keen demand for all coming forward best heavy-weight wethers up to 13s ; ' medium 10s to lis 6d ; fat ewes, 10s 6d for good weight. Store sheep— This , class of stock is at last going up rapidly, . and good demand for all classes. We have sold good ewes in lamb, 4 and 6- , tooth, up to 8s 6d ; f.m. do and mixed lots, 3s 6d to 7s ; store wethers, fresh, to 9s. Hoggets are in good demand ; we could place large numbers up to 6s for best. Cattle— Fat bullocks, 18s 6d per 1001 b; cows, 15s per 1001 b. Store cattle— Good, we might also say keen, demand for all young cattle for sale ; Weaner,s 18s to 245 ; yearlings, 35s to 455 ; 2-year steers, 60s to 70s ; 3*years, 80s to 90s. The demand is not so keen for grown bullocks. Dairy cattle — Demand for cows is easier, except for those just calved and good young milkers, which we have sold at up to £8. Pigs Good demand for porkers. Sheepskins — Home reports are favorable ; all coming forward are selling freely at enhanced prices, up to 5d for best country dry skins, best green skins up to 4s 6d, and 3s to 3s 6d for medium. Wool — Only odd lots coming forward and readily saleable. We advise sellers to send all skins, etc., forward in good time so as to take advantage of the buoyant market. At our horse sale we had a very small entry, bnt a good attendance. Heavy young sound draughts, £24 to L2B; medium and aged, Ll4 to L 1 8; good cx r press horses, Ll6. Any really good horses suitable for express or heavy dray work would find buyers at above quotations. . >
